Output 82156a24baeb82659bef84f02a7db54fdcb50d4edef05fae91ebb321ad85750b:0
- value
- 6298439
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77d0509c784681f7a0cde9f53bc288550409084e OP_EQUAL
- address
- 3CcXtLtUnUggor5E9vYrrVrCsvennxUeiC
- transaction
- 82156a24baeb82659bef84f02a7db54fdcb50d4edef05fae91ebb321ad85750b
- confirmations
- 351353
- spent
- true